We are looking for a Sales Director to join our growing business. You will lead an existing team of Strategic Enterprise Account Executives and you will be measured by achieving your team’s overall quota and growing Databricks usage. This is a team of Strategic Account Executives that are passionate about building a data ecosystem, technically knowledgeable, and have a desire to help customers and partners succeed. You will report to the Regional Vice President.

The impact you will have:

  • Lead, grow and inspire the Strategic Enterprise Account Executives to help them overachieve on their goals and objectives.
  • Instill a culture of teamwork focused on leading with measurable business value and achieving desired customer outcomes.
  • Develop trust-based relationships with customers and partners to ensure long-term success.
  • Drive ongoing learning of the continuous innovation being delivered to our customers via our data intelligence and GenAI solutions.
  • Actively participate in the region’s growth plans, ensure forecast accuracy and build a customer-focused, durable, high-growth business.

What we look for:

  • You live the Databricks’ core values and instill them in the team you are leading.
  • You will have 5+ years of successfully building and leading high-growth sales teams serving enterprise customers within the Big Data, Cloud (Azure, AWS, GCP), Analytics, AI spaces.
  • History of exceeding quota and thriving in hyper-growth Enterprise technology companies.
  • Understanding of value selling and sales methodologies such as MEDDPICC, Challenger, Command of Message.
  • Knowledge of developing partner ecosystems to help grow strategic enterprise territories and ensure customer success.
  • Strong Retail industry experience is preferred 
  • With this role, a proven track record of leading teams to success when focused on enterprise territories and driving consumption is critical.

About Databricks

Databricks is the Data and AI company. More than 20,000 organizations worldwide — including adidas, AT&T, Bayer, Block, Mastercard, Rivian, Unilever, and 70% of the Fortune 500 — rely on the Databricks Data + AI Platform to build and scale data and AI apps, analytics and agents. Headquartered in San Francisco with 30+ offices around the globe, Databricks offers a unified platform that includes Genie, Lakebase, Agent Bricks, Lakeflow, Lakehouse, and Unity Catalog.
